PSG have a major decision on their hands—and clubs like Inter Milan and Manchester United are watching closely. Is Gianluigi Donnarumma still their long-term answer in goal?

The Italian keeper is under contract through 2026, but interest from top European clubs is starting to build. Since joining from AC Milan in 2021, Donnarumma has delivered in big moments, especially in penalty shootouts and high-pressure saves. Still, his time in Paris hasn’t been without hiccups.

One moment that still lingers is his costly error against Real Madrid in the 2022 Champions League, raising questions about whether he can be trusted when the stakes are highest.

Now that PSG have finally conquered Europe, attention turns to the future. Donnarumma’s recent form has helped solidify his role as the club’s No. 1, but with just over a year left on his deal, other clubs are preparing to pounce if PSG stall on an extension.

Could PSG lose out on Gianluigi Donnarumma replacement?

If talks don’t progress, PSG could be forced to consider selling this summer to avoid losing him for nothing.

As for potential replacements, BILD has linked PSG to Marc-André ter Stegen, should he leave Barcelona. Other possible destinations mentioned include AC Milan, Manchester City, Juventus, and Newcastle United.

However, SPORT reports that Galatasaray have already made a move for the 33-year-old with an offer, though Fichajes recently revealed that ter Stegen isn’t planning to leave. According to the report, the German international blames Deco and Hansi Flick for pushing him toward the exit.
